如何使excel自定義函式成為內建函式
1樓:張光越
先錄製乙個巨集 記住錄製的時候選擇儲存到個人巨集工作簿 錄製完以後你的vbaide裡的工程欄就多了乙個的文件,把你自己編寫的function函式複製到這個工作簿的模組中 就可以在所有工作簿中引用了 主意function不能 private
2樓:方括號
在檔案中建立這個自定義函式,檔案最好只有這個自定義函式,並且只留乙個工作表,另存為microsoft office excel 載入巨集(在儲存型別裡選擇)。
以後需要使用時,工具-載入巨集,勾上這個載入巨集就可以用了。
3樓:網友
沒辦法成為內建函式的。不過你可以使用載入巨集的辦法在每次excel啟動時都可以使用,就像內建函式一樣方便。方法如下:
1、新建乙個空白工作表,在裡面設定好自定義函式(注意:必須儲存在標準模組中,必須以public開頭, 不能使用private)然後在儲存對話方塊的儲存型別中儲存為載入巨集,2003字尾名為xla,2007以上字尾名為xlam。可以儲存在任意資料夾。
然後關閉excel。
2、重啟excel,2003版單擊選單欄工具→載入巨集→瀏覽→找到你剛才儲存的檔案→確定。2007以上版單擊「office 按鈕」→單擊「excel 選項」→在「excel選項」對話方塊中單擊「載入項」→直接單擊「轉到」,彈出「載入項」視窗→單擊「瀏覽」,查詢並選擇載入巨集檔案,單擊「確定」。
怎麼在excel中建立自定義函式
4樓:網友
在excel介面中,按下「alt+f11」組合鍵,彈出microsoft visual basic介面,如下圖。
上圖中,執行選單操作:「插入」→「模組」;之後,會彈出如下圖的模組1(**)的**編寫視窗。
左邊選擇「通用」,然後輸入上圖中的**即可。
5樓:清風吧吧啦
建立自定義函式,快捷鍵alt+f11開啟vbe視窗,在工程資源管理器中新建乙個模組或者在插入選單中新建模組,**編寫模式如下:
function 函式名稱(引數1 as 資料型別,引數2 as 資料型別,……
**1**2
**2……函式名稱=**結果 '這一句很關鍵。
end function
如果只是在本工作簿中使用,直接在工作表中寫公式=函式名稱(引數,引數),當輸入第乙個函式字母時excel會在函式列表中提示這個字母為首的函式。
如果要在excel應用程式中使用此自定義函式,就要將寫好的**另存為。xla或者。xlam載入巨集的工作簿,具體按照你的excel版本。
最後在載入巨集中勾選你儲存的載入巨集名稱。這樣在開啟任何乙個工作簿時都可以使用這個函式。
怎樣在excel中插入自定義函式
6樓:一騎當後
方法/步驟。
1、點選「工具」中的「巨集」,選擇「visual basic器」項(按「alt+f11」快捷鍵一樣效果),。
2、在執行1步驟後跳出「visual basic器-book1」視窗,。
3、在「visual basic器-book1」視窗中,點選「插入」中的「模組」項,。
4、執行3步驟,會跳出如下命令視窗,。
5、在「book1-模組1(**)」視窗裡輸入:
function s(a, b)
s = a * b / 2
end function
6、function s(a, b)是定義函式及引數的,自定義函式必須首先這麼定義自己的函式,然後以end function作結束。輸入完畢,關閉視窗,自定義的函式就完成了。
8、**中,點選c3單元格,在fx處輸入「=s(a3,b3)」就行了,只要一回車確定,面積就出來了,。
9、c4單元格面積的確定,和c3單元格一樣,只是「=s(a4,b4)」依次類推。其實,其他函式也差不多類似這樣做,只是有時候自定義複雜函式,需要基本的數學知識和vba基礎,這需用自身的積累。
7樓:洋老師辦公教程
方法有兩種,第一種,單擊我們需要插入函式的單元格,輸入等於,然後我們就可以輸入函式。方法二,在上方選項卡公式下面,有乙個插入函式,點選之後我們可以直接輸入,或者選擇我們需要的公式都行。
excel自定義函式怎麼製作
8樓:無錫太湖學院
alt+f11,點選「插入」-「模組」
function test(str as string)test = "0" & str
end function
以上就是乙個簡單的自定義函式。將傳入的str前加0。
在某個單元格輸入 =test(a1) 後,將顯示0與a1合併的結果。
9樓:網友
我只會最簡單的,說一下:
alt+f11,開啟巨集;
新建模組1,輸入:
function z(a, b)
z = a * b
end function
退出,你就自定義了乙個z的函式,如果你在單元格中輸入=z(a1,a2),返回的值就是a1和a2單元格的乘積。每次開啟檔案,啟用巨集。
10樓:網友
答的竟然和樓上神似,刪了。樓上答的很好。:)
如何在excel中建立乙個自定義函式?請大家指教
11樓:姿嶄貝駁
在excel介面中,按下「alt+f11」組合鍵,彈出microsoftvisualbasic介面,如下圖上圖中,執行選單操作:「插入」→「模組」;之後,會彈出如下圖的模組1(**)的**編寫視窗。左邊選擇「通用」,然後輸入上圖中的**即可。
自定義常量定義應該在哪,C語言自定義函式中定義常量 變數的問題
define和const 1.define是巨集定義,程式在預處理階段將用define定義的內容進行了替換。因此程式執行時,常量表中並沒有用define定義的常量,系統不為它分配記憶體。const定義的常量,在程式執行時在常量表中,系統為它分配記憶體。2.define定義的常量,預處理時只是直接進行...
jquery點選後執行自定義函式
jquery 可以可以使用元素的click方法來執行操作,或者執行乙個自定義的函式都是可以的。例如 function say function ul li a click function 不需要 this 如何在按鈕單擊事件中執行自定義函式 至於按鈕單擊執行自定義函式的方專法,那要看你執行屬的自定...
python自定義函式怎麼用,python中怎麼呼叫自定義函式
def hello name print hello,name hello tom 簡單的函式示例 python中怎麼呼叫自定義函式 如果自定義函式,是在當前檔案中定義的,直接呼叫即可,就像樓上回答的一樣 如果是在別的模組中定義的,那麼要在當前檔案中呼叫,就需要先導入對應的模組,匯入方法 在當前檔案...